publications
How do children organize their speech in the first years of life? Insight from ultrasound imaging
Noiray, A., Abakarova, D., Rubertus, E., Krüger, S., & Tiede, M. (2018). How do children organize their speech in the first years of life? Insight from ultrasound imaging. Journal of Speech, Language, and Hearing Research, 61(6), 1355-1368.
On the development of gestural organization: A cross-sectional study of vowel-to-vowel anticipatory coarticulation
Rubertus, E., & Noiray, A. (2018). On the development of gestural organization: A cross-sectional study of vowel-to-vowel anticipatory coarticulation. PLOS ONE, 13(9), e0203562.
Back from the future: nonlinear anticipation in adults’ and children’s speech
Noiray, A., Wieling, M., Abakarova, D., Rubertus, E., & Tiede, M. (2019). Back from the future: nonlinear anticipation in adults’ and children’s speech. Journal of Speech, Language, and Hearing Research 62(8S), 3033-3054.
Spoken language development and the challenge of skill integration
Noiray, A., Popescu, A., Killmer, H., Rubertus, E., Krüger, S., & Hintermeier, L. (2019). Spoken language development and the challenge of skill integration. Frontiers in Psychology, 10, 2777.
Vocalic activation width decreases across childhood – evidence from carryover coarticulation
Rubertus, E. & Noiray, A. (2020). Vocalic activation width decreases across childhood – evidence from carryover coarticulation. Journal of Laboratory Phonology, 11(1), 7.
Recording and analyzing kinematic data in children and adults with SOLLAR: Sonographic & Optical Linguo-Labial Articulation Recording system
Noiray, A., Ries, J., Tiede, M., Rubertus, E., Laporte, C., & Ménard, L. (2020). Recording and analyzing kinematic data in children and adults with SOLLAR: Sonographic & Optical Linguo-Labial Articulation Recording system. Journal of Laboratory Phonology, 11(1), 14.
Coarticulatory changes across childhood – implications for speech motor and phonological development
Rubertus, E. (2024). Coarticulatory changes across childhood – implications for speech motor and phonological development. (Doctoral dissertation). University of Potsdam.
Children’s coarticulation patterns as a window to the phonology-phonetics interface
Rubertus, E. & Noiray, A. (2024). Children’s coarticulation patterns as a window to the phonology-phonetics interface. Proc. ISSP 2024 – 13th International Seminar on Speech Production, 43-46.
Variation in the temporal extent of anticipatory coarticulation across three speech modalities in children: an ultrasound study
Popescu, A., Rubertus, E., & Noiray, A. (2024). Variation in the temporal extent of anticipatory coarticulation across three speech modalities in children: an ultrasound study. In I Wilson, A. Mizoguchi, J. Perkins, J. Villegas, & N. Yamane (Eds.), Ultrafest XI: Extended Abstracts (pp. 136-139). University of Aizu.
Ultrasound imaging can track subtle reading disfluencies: Insights from reading children and adults
Rubertus, E., Popescu, A., & Noiray, A. (2024). Ultrasound imaging can track subtle reading disfluencies: Insights from reading children and adults. In I Wilson, A. Mizoguchi, J. Perkins, J. Villegas, & N. Yamane (Eds.), Ultrafest XI: Extended Abstracts (pp.151-154). University of Aizu.
Seriality in word reading: Kinematic insights into beginning and proficient readers
Rubertus, E., Popescu, A., & Noiray, A. (2025). Seriality in word reading: Kinematic insights into beginning and proficient readers. Journal of Experimental Psychology: Learning, Memory, and Cognition. Advance online publication. https://dx.doi.org/10.1037/xlm0001513
